pbAnnual population growth rate at 0.78 percent/b/p p align="JUSTIFY"The population of Romblon was 279,774 persons as of August 1, 2007, based on the 2007 Census of Population. This figure was higher by 15,417 persons over the population count of 264,357 persons in 2000. The population count of the province for the 2000 and 2007 censuses translated to an average annual population growth rate of 0.78 percent./p p align="JUSTIFY"In 2007, the number of households reached 58,021, which was 4,290 households more than the 53,731 households in 2000. The average household size in 2007 was 4.8 persons, slightly lower than the average household size of 4.9 persons in 2000./p p align="JUSTIFY"bOdiongan was the most populated municipality/b/p p align="JUSTIFY"Among the 17 municipalities in the province, Odiongan was the most populous with 15.0 percent share to the provincial population. It was followed by the municipalities of Romblon, the provincial capital (13.4 percent), San Fernando (8.0 percent), San Agustin (7.9 percent), Cajidiocan (7.6 percent), and Looc (7.4 percent). The rest of the municipalities contributed less than six percent each. The municipality of Concepcion was the least populous with 1.5 percent share to the total provincial population./p p align="center" /p p align="JUSTIFY"bMales outnumbered females in the household population/b/p p align="JUSTIFY"Of the 279,177 household population of Romblon, 50.9 percent were males and 49.1 percent were females. The sex ratio was recorded at 103 males for every 100 females, slightly higher than the sex ratio of 102 males per 100 females in 2000./p p align="JUSTIFY"bMore younger males than females/b/p p align="JUSTIFY"The household population of Romblon had a median age of 19 years, which means that half of the household population were below 19 years old. The same median age was recorded in 2000./p p align="JUSTIFY"Age group 10 to 14 years contributed the highest share to household population with 13.9 percent, followed by those in age groups 5 to 9 years (13.7 percent) and 0 to 4 years (13.4 percent)./p p align="center" /p p align="JUSTIFY"There were more males than females in age brackets 0 to 39 years and 45 to 49 years, while more females than males were reported in age brackets 40 to 44 years and 50 years and over./p p align="JUSTIFY"bOver fifty percent of the household population were in the voting-age population/b/p p align="JUSTIFY"More than half (52.2 percent) of the household population of Romblon were of voting ages (18 years old and over). The distribution of voting-age population by sex was 50.4 percent for females and 49.6 percent for males./p p align="JUSTIFY"bOverall dependency ratio increased to 89 dependents per 100 persons in the working age group/b/p p align="JUSTIFY"The proportion of household population in the working age group (15 to 64 years) was 52.9 percent. Young dependents (0 to 14 years) comprised 41.0 percent while old dependents (65 years and over) accounted for 6.1 percent./p p align="JUSTIFY"In 2007, the overall dependency ratio was 89, which means that for every 100 persons in the working age group, there were 89 dependents (78 young dependents and 11 old dependents). In 2000, there were about 85 dependents (75 young dependents and 10 old dependents) per 100 persons in the working age group./p p align="JUSTIFY"bMore never-married males than females/b/p p align="JUSTIFY"Approximately 44.5 percent of the household population 10 years old and over in 2007 were never married while 43.6 percent were married. The rest of the population was either widowed (5.9 percent), divorced/separated (0.8 percent), had common law/live-in marital arrangement (4.9 percent), or had unknown marital status (0.3 percent). Among never-married persons, there were more males (56.3 percent) than females (43.7 percent). Females outnumbered males in the rest of the categories for marital status./p p align="JUSTIFY"bHigher levels of education and school attendance for females than males/b/p p align="JUSTIFY"Of the household population 5 years old and over, 45.7 percent had attended or finished elementary education while 30.1 percent had reached or completed high school. The proportion of academic degree holders was 5.3 percent, an increase of 2.2 percentage points from the 2000 figure of 3.1 percent./p p align="JUSTIFY"More females had attained higher levels of education than males, as majority of those with academic degrees (60.3 percent) and post baccalaureate courses (62.6 percent) were females./p p align="JUSTIFY"Among the household population 5 to 24 years old, 73.4 percent had attended school at anytime during School Year 2007 to 2008. School attendance among females (75.0 percent of all females aged 5 to 24 years) was higher compared to that of males (72.0 percent of all males aged 5 to 24 years) during the said school year./p p align="JUSTIFY"bNumber of occupied housing units increased by 4,414/b/p p align="JUSTIFY"The number of occupied housing units in 2007 reached 57,692, indicating an increase of 8.3 percent from 53,278 occupied housing units in 2000. The average number of households for every 100 occupied housing units in 2007 and 2000 were the same at 101 households. As to the number of persons per occupied housing unit, a ratio of 4.8 persons per occupied housing unit was recorded in 2007, slightly lower than the ratio of 5.0 persons per occupied housing unit in 2000./p p align="JUSTIFY"bUse of strong materials for roof and outer walls increased/b/p p align="JUSTIFY"Increase in the materials used for outer walls was noted in 2007 compared with that in 2000. The proportion of occupied housing units with outer walls made of concrete/brick/stone increased from 25.6 percent in 2000 to 31.3 percent in 2007. On the other hand, the proportion of occupied housing units with outer walls made of bamboo/sawali/anahaw dropped from 42.9 percent in 2000 to 39.4 percent in 2007, or a difference of 3.5 percentage points./p p align="JUSTIFY"Over half (50.5 percent) of the occupied housing units in 2007 had roofs made of galvanized iron/aluminum. Use of cogon/nipa/anahaw as roofing materials was 41.3 percent, showing a decrease of 13.7 percentage points from the 2000 figure./p p align="JUSTIFY" /p p style="text-align: -webkit-left; " /p table border="0" width="100%" tbody tr td colspan="80%" /td td align="CENTER" nowrap="nowrap"(Sgd.) bCARMELITA N.
